The Best Futures Trading Hours in Energy: CL opens for trading on the floor, called the pit session at 9AM EST. European trading closes at 11:30 AM EST. The best hours for trading are the most liquid, between 9:00AM and 11:30AM. Pit session closes at 2:30PM EST, when floor trading stops for the day.

As the number of available futures contracts per day is relatively large, for the estimation analysis, the most liquid futures contracts are used, with liquidity measured by the open interest. As contracts close to expiry have very low liquidity, the contracts selected for the study here all have more than 14 days to expiry.

We test our algorithms on the 50 most liquid futures ...The full contract value of the FDAX at a price level of 12,500 can be calculated as follows: 12,500 x €25 = €312,500. In this case, the full contract value is €312,500. Margin is only a fraction of the full contract value and is not the same at all brokers. At many US brokers, for example, margin is only $2,500.

In Europe, we are the most liquid on-exchange marketplace for trading and hedging through the UK NBP and Dutch TTF futures contract. And in Asia, where underdeveloped infrastructure means LNG is a key source of natural gas, our JKM LNG futures contract has become the benchmark for pricing across the region.
